Veterinary Services in Close Proximity
Ensuring your pet has access to excellent veterinary care is crucial. Gillett itself has limited veterinary options, but a quick drive to Elmira, NY, reveals numerous clinics like the Broadway Animal Hospital. For emergencies, the Cornell University Hospital for Animals, located in Ithaca, NY, offers world-renowned specialized care. These facilities ensure that whether it's a routine check-up or a medical emergency, your pet is in good hands.
Outdoor Spaces for Adventures
Gillett may not have designated dog parks, but its open countryside and nearby recreation areas provide excellent opportunities for outdoor fun. The nearby Mt. Pisgah State Park offers extensive trails where dogs are welcome on leashes, and its expansive open spaces are perfect for an afternoon romp. Your cat might enjoy the serene outdoor settings here, too, although it’s generally safer to keep them on a harness or indoors.
Pet-Friendly Attractions and Housing
When it comes to pet-friendly venues, Gillett offers a quaint but growing selection. Some local cafes like the Gillett Coffee Haus have pet-friendly patios where you can enjoy a cup of coffee accompanied by your dog. However, choices can be limited, and a venture into Elmira or Towanda might provide more pet-friendly dining spots.
Finding pet-friendly housing in Gillett is relatively easier compared to larger, more competitive rental markets. Many local landlords are open to pets, often with reasonable pet deposits and minimal restrictions. While it might not be as formalized as in bigger cities, this flexibility can be a boon for pet owners.
